How to Sell an Insurance Agency: Case Study of a $1.1M Farmers Agency Sale

Selling an insurance agency—especially a captive insurance agency such as Farmers, State Farm, or Allstate—is a unique process. These businesses operate under contractual agreements with the carrier, which affects valuation, buyer qualifications, and deal structure. The Importance of Confidentiality When Selling Business

Confidentiality when Selling Business is one of the most critical factors in ensuring a smooth and successful transaction. If word gets out too soon that your business is for sale, it could lead to employee uncertainty, customer loss, supplier concerns, and even competitive threats.
